Q: Is 13,033,524 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 13,033,524 is a composite number.

Why is 13,033,524 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 13,033,524 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 7 12 14 21 28 42 84 155,161 310,322 465,483 620,644 930,966 1,086,127 1,861,932 2,172,254 3,258,381 4,344,508 6,516,762 and 13,033,524, with no remainder.

Since 13,033,524 cannot be divided by just 1 and 13,033,524, it is a composite number.
